プロジェクト

全般

プロフィール

Bug(バグ) #1559

完了

【3.4系限定】アクティビティガジェットの表示が崩れる

Mutsumi Imamura さんが約14年前に追加. 約14年前に更新.

ステータス:
Fixed(完了)
優先度:
Normal(通常)
担当者:
対象バージョン:
開始日:
2010-09-06
期日:
進捗率:

100%

予定工数:
3.6 で発生するか:
No
3.8 で発生するか:

説明

Overview (現象)

OpenPNE3.4でアクティビティガジェットをマイホームに追加し、IE6またはIE7でマイホームにアクセスすると表示が崩れてしまう。(添付画像を参照ください)

再現バージョン

  • OpenPNE3.4.7-dev(3.4系のみ再現)

3.6では構造が違うため再現しません

再現ブラウザ

  • IE6
  • IE7

Causes (原因)

Way to fix (修正内容)


ファイル

IE6_34x_myfriend_activity_display_error.PNG (71.3 KB) IE6_34x_myfriend_activity_display_error.PNG Mutsumi Imamura, 2010-09-06 17:00
Firefox_34x_myfriends_activity.png (23.2 KB) Firefox_34x_myfriends_activity.png Firefoxで表示した場合 Mutsumi Imamura, 2010-10-05 17:50
ie6.png (19.1 KB) ie6.png IE6で表示咲いた際のキャプチャ Hiroki Mogi, 2010-10-07 15:16

関連するチケット 2 (0件未完了2件完了)

関連している OpenPNE 3 - Bug(バグ) #1333: アクティビティの画像がずれる(IE)Invalid(無効)2010-07-13

操作
関連している OpenPNE 3 - Bug(バグ) #1095: Design of activity is too bad (アクティビティのデザインが正しくない)Fixed(完了)Shogo Kawahara2010-05-21

操作

Mutsumi Imamura さんが約14年前に更新

  • ファイル を削除 (IE6_34x_myfriend_activity_display_error.PNG)

Minoru Takai さんが約14年前に更新

  • ステータスNew(新規) から Accepted(着手) に変更
  • 担当者Minoru Takai にセット

Minoru Takai さんが約14年前に更新

3.6系は #1095 でアクティビティ周りの改善を行っています。

#1095 をバックポート対応するか、IE6,7だけの崩れを修正するかは改めて判断します。

また、現状の3.4系では opSkinClassicPlugin を適用するとアクティビティ周りが全てのブラウザで大幅に崩れると思われます。

Minoru Takai さんが約14年前に更新

このチケットではバックポート対応は行わず、アイコンのレイアウトが崩れる点のみを修正します。

Mutsumi Imamura さんが約14年前に更新

参考にFirefoxでのキャプチャ画像を追加します。

Minoru Takai さんが約14年前に更新

  • ステータスAccepted(着手) から Pending Review(レビュー待ち) に変更
  • 進捗率0 から 50 に変更

更新履歴 02c495452e543aa2b157ab218bef5e86ff4ff382 で適用されました。

Minoru Takai さんが約14年前に更新

opSkinBasicPlugin に対して、画像がずれる点のみを修正しました。

opSkinClassicPlugin の大幅な崩れに対するCSSのみによる修正を用意していますが、このチケットでは Classic プラグインは扱わないことにします。

参考までにCSSを提示しておきます。(以下のCSSは、3.4.x で opSkinClassicPlugin を使用する際に、カスタムCSSに追加することで大幅な崩れを防ぐためのものです。崩れに対する本質的な解決方法ではありません:本質的な解決は #1095 に相当する修正です)

/*==========================================================
 * Common Style
 *--------------------------------------------------------*/
#Left,
#Center,
#Top,
div.parts {
  zoom: 1;
}

/*==========================================================
 * Activity
 *--------------------------------------------------------*/
div.activityBox div.moreInfo {
  padding-bottom: 5px;
}
#delete_activity,
div.activityBox {
  zoom: 1;
  word-wrap: break-word;
}

/*======================================
 * form part
 *------------------------------------*/
div.activityBox form {
  padding: 0 4px;
}
div.activityBox form div.count {
  float: right;
  padding-right: 6px;
  color: #888888;
  font-size: 24px;
  font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
}
div.activityBox form select {
  margin-left: 8px;
}
div.activityBox form textarea {
  display: block;
  width: 98%;
  height: 3.5em;
  margin: 4px auto;
}
div.activityBox form br {
  display: none;
}
div.activityBox form * br {
  display: block;
}
div.activityBox form input.submit {
  float: right;
  margin-right: 3px;
}

/*======================================
 * activity list part
 *------------------------------------*/
div.activityBox ol.activities {
  clear: both;
}
#delete_activity ol.activities li.activity,
div.activityBox ol.activities li.activity {
  clear: both;
  padding: 10px 6px 8px;
  border-bottom: 1px solid #cccccc;
}
#delete_activity ol.activities li.activity div.memberImage,
div.activityBox ol.activities li.activity div.memberImage {
  overflow: hidden;
  z-index: 256;
  position: relative;
  float: left;
  width: 76px;
  max-height: 76px;
  margin-right: 8px;
}
#delete_activity ol.activities li.activity div.body,
div.activityBox ol.activities li.activity div.body {
  overflow: hidden;
  z-index: 128;
  position: relative;
  min-height: 76px;
  padding: 0;
}
* html #delete_activity ol.activities li.activity div.body,
* html div.activityBox ol.activities li.activity div.body {
  height: 76px;
}
#delete_activity ol.activities li.activity div.body div.info,
div.activityBox ol.activities li.activity div.body div.info {
  padding-top: 2px;
  color: #888888;
}
#delete_activity div.parts div.operation,
div.activityBox ol.activities li.activity div.operation {
  border: none;
}

Hiroki Mogi さんが約14年前に更新

IE6にて表示の崩れている部分がありました。
ステータスを差し戻しに変更します。

Hiroki Mogi さんが約14年前に更新

  • ステータスPending Review(レビュー待ち) から Rejected(差し戻し) に変更

Minoru Takai さんが約14年前に更新

  • ステータスRejected(差し戻し) から Accepted(着手) に変更

対応します。

Minoru Takai さんが約14年前に更新

  • ステータスAccepted(着手) から Pending Review(レビュー待ち) に変更

更新履歴 3d30392772cf2336e4ba43a93bfcd3f79c42eb33 で適用されました。

Mutsumi Imamura さんが約14年前に更新

アクティビティ投稿ボタンがIE6、IE7とFirefox3などとでは表示が違いますが、
ブラウザの仕様ということでバグではありません。実装者にも確認済みです。

動作としても問題がないことを確認しました。
テストはこれでOKです。

Rimpei Ogawa さんが約14年前に更新

  • ステータスPending Review(レビュー待ち) から Pending Testing(テスト待ち) に変更
  • 進捗率50 から 70 に変更

Shinichi Urabe さんが約14年前に更新

  • ステータスPending Testing(テスト待ち) から Fixed(完了) に変更
  • 進捗率70 から 100 に変更

テストは完了しているので閉じます

他の形式にエクスポート: Atom PDF